San Antonio Christian had to travel to play their first game of the season, but the final result was worth the trip. They were the clear victors by a 3-0 margin over the Harlandale Indians on Tuesday. That result was just more of the same for these two, as the Lions also won the last time the pair played back in August of 2024.
San Antonio Christian walked away with the victory (and looked especially good in the second set).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-17, 25-14, 25-18.
Sara Cleveland paced San Antonio Christian's offense, picking up nine kills. Cleveland got some help from Annabelle Warren and her 14 assists. Sydney Smith controlled things from the service line, finishing with three aces.
Both squads are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. San Antonio Christian will square off against TMI-Episcopal at 2:00 p.m. on Wednesday. As for Harlandale, they will challenge Poteet at 9:00 a.m. on Friday.
